Rolex watches are renowned for their exceptional craftsmanship, timeless design, and precision engineering. One of the distinguishing features of older Rolex models is the use of plexiglass crystals, which were commonly used before the widespread adoption of sapphire crystals in luxury watches. While plexiglass crystals may be more prone to scratches and scuffs compared to sapphire, they can be easily polished to restore their original luster. Rolex Watch Crystal Look

The plexiglass crystal on a Rolex watch has a distinct appearance that differs from sapphire crystals. Plexiglass is a type of acrylic material that is lightweight, durable, and highly transparent. While plexiglass crystals are more prone to scratching compared to sapphire, they are easier to polish and can be restored to their original clarity with the right techniques. The domed shape of the plexiglass crystal on Rolex GMT models adds a vintage touch to the watch, reflecting light in a unique way that enhances the overall look of the timepiece.

Rolex Acrylic Crystals

Rolex acrylic crystals, also known as plexiglass crystals, are made from a type of acrylic material that is lightweight, impact-resistant, and highly transparent. Acrylic crystals were commonly used in watchmaking before the widespread adoption of sapphire crystals due to their cost-effectiveness and ease of manufacturing. While acrylic crystals may be more prone to scratching compared to sapphire, they can be easily polished to remove minor imperfections and restore their original clarity.
